Ratanpur - Akbarpur, Nawada

Ratanpur is a village situated in the Akbarpur subdivision of Nawada district, Bihar. It is located approximately 2 km from the tehsil headquarters in Akbarpur and around 22 km from the district headquarters in Nawada. Budhuwa ser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ratanp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Ratanpur is 258026. The village covers a total geographical area of 104 hectares and falls under the 805126 pincode. Nawada is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Ratanp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head.

Population of Ratanpur

According to the 2011 Census, Ratanpur village had a total population of 1,621 people, including 850 males and 771 females, living in 216 households. The sex ratio was 907 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 64.09%, with male literacy at 71.73% and female literacy at 56.01%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 280.

Transport and Connectivity of Ratanpur

Ratanp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Chatar Halt, while the nearest airport is Dhanbad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 108.0 km.
